A linear function models any process that has a constant rate of change.

m = change in y-value

change in x-value

The graph of a linear function is a straight line.

A linear function has the form:

y = f(x) = b + mx

where

f is the name of the function.

b is the starting value or y intercept (f(0)).

m is the constant rate of change or slope.

slope intercept form

An exponential function models any process in which function values change by a fixed ratio or percentage.

The graph of an exponential function is curvy.

An exponential function has the form:

y = f(x) = c * ax

where

f is the name of the function.

c is the starting value or y intercept (f(0)).

a is the growth factor.
